Изучите методы чтения файла Excel с помощью PHPExcel

Часто возникает необходимость в считывании данных из файлов Excel в приложениях, написанных на языке программирования PHP. Для этой цели можно использовать библиотеку PHPExcel, которая предоставляет удобные инструменты для работы с файлами Excel.

PHPExcel позволяет считывать данные из файлов формата .xls и .xlsx, а также производить множество дополнительных операций, таких как запись данных, форматирование ячеек и создание новых файлов Excel. Благодаря широким возможностям библиотеки, вы сможете эффективно работать с данными файла Excel прямо из PHP-кода.

Для начала работы с PHPExcel необходимо установить библиотеку и подключить ее в свой проект. Затем вы сможете приступить к чтению данных из файла Excel. Например, вы можете считать данные из всех или определенных листов файла, обрабатывать значения ячеек, выполнять операции с формулами и многое другое.

Считывание данных из файла Excel с помощью PHPExcel является простым и эффективным способом получить доступ к информации, сохраненной в файлах Excel. Независимо от того, нужно ли вам считать данные для анализа или обработки, использование PHPExcel позволит вам быстро и точно выполнить задачу.

Благодаря гибкости и мощности PHPExcel вы сможете легко интегрировать файлы Excel в ваши проекты на PHP и управлять данными, необходимыми для вашего приложения. Необходимость в чтении файлов Excel станет проще благодаря использованию PHPExcel и его удобным функциям.

Установка и настройка PHPExcel

Первым шагом является загрузка самой библиотеки PHPExcel. Вы можете скачать ее с официального сайта или использовать менеджер пакетов Composer для установки. Если вы используете Composer, вам нужно просто добавить строку в файл composer.json и запустить команду «composer install».

После установки PHPExcel вам нужно подключить его в вашем PHP-скрипте. Для этого вы можете использовать функцию «require_once», указав путь к файлу PHPExcel.php. После подключения библиотеки вы можете использовать все ее функции и классы для работы с файлами Excel.

Для работы с файлами Excel в PHPExcel необходимо создать экземпляр класса PHPExcel. С помощью этого класса вы сможете загружать, создавать, редактировать и сохранять файлы Excel. Для создания экземпляра класса вы можете использовать следующий код:

$objPHPExcel = new PHPExcel();

Когда вы создали экземпляр класса PHPExcel, вы можете использовать различные методы для работы с файлами Excel. Например, вы можете загружать существующий файл Excel с помощью метода «load», создавать новые листы Excel с помощью метода «createSheet», а также заполнять ячейки Excel данными с помощью метода «setCellValue». После того, как вы внесли все необходимые изменения в файл Excel, вы можете сохранить его с помощью метода «save», указав путь, по которому вы хотите сохранить файл.

Читайте также:  Windows 10 ошибка 0x800700df размер файла превышает установленное ограничение

Открытие и чтение файла excel с помощью PHPExcel

PHPExcel предоставляет удобные методы для чтения и записи данных в формате Excel. Для начала работы с PHPExcel, необходимо подключить эту библиотеку к проекту. Вы можете скачать ее с официального сайта PHPExcel и установить в свой проект.

После подключения библиотеки PHPExcel, можно приступить к чтению файла Excel. Для этого необходимо создать объект класса PHPExcel, указать путь к файлу и вызвать метод для загрузки данных. Например, если файл Excel называется «data.xlsx» и находится в корневой папке проекта, то код для чтения файла может выглядеть следующим образом:

$objPHPExcel = PHPExcel_IOFactory::load('data.xlsx');

После загрузки данных, мы можем получить доступ к содержимому файла и выполнять различные операции с этими данными. Например, мы можем получить значения ячеек, изменять их значения, фильтровать данные, сортировать таблицу и т. д.

PHPExcel также предоставляет удобные инструменты для работы с различными форматами данных, такими как числа, строки, даты и т. д. Вы можете легко преобразовывать данные из одного формата в другой и выполнять другие операции с данными в Excel файле.

В этой статье мы рассмотрели процесс открытия и чтения файла Excel с помощью PHPExcel. Мы обсудили, как подключить библиотеку PHPExcel к проекту, как загрузить данные из файла и как выполнять операции с этими данными. Теперь вы можете применить эти знания в вашем проекте и удобно работать с данными в формате Excel.

Извлечение данных из файла Excel в PHP

Способ 1: Использование библиотеки PHPExcel

Одним из наиболее распространенных способов извлечения данных из Excel-файлов в PHP является использование библиотеки PHPExcel. Эта библиотека предоставляет удобные методы для чтения и записи файлов Excel в формате XLS и XLSX.

Читайте также:  Back seat windows up

Для начала работы с библиотекой PHPExcel необходимо скачать и установить ее на свой сервер. После установки можно начать использовать методы библиотеки для чтения данных из Excel-файлов. Например, чтобы прочитать все данные из файла Excel, можно использовать следующий код:

require_once 'PHPExcel/PHPExcel.php';
$inputFileType = PHPExcel_IOFactory::identify('example.xlsx');
$objReader = PHPExcel_IOFactory::createReader($inputFileType);
$objPHPExcel = $objReader->load('example.xlsx');
$worksheet = $objPHPExcel->getActiveSheet();
$highestRow = $worksheet->getHighestRow();
$highestColumn = $worksheet->getHighestColumn();
$data = array();
for ($row = 1; $row <= $highestRow; $row++) {
for ($col = 'A'; $col <= $highestColumn; $col++) {
$value = $worksheet->getCell($col.$row)->getValue();
$data[$row][$col] = $value;
}
}

Способ 2: Использование библиотеки PHPSpreadsheet

Библиотека PHPSpreadsheet является современной альтернативой библиотеке PHPExcel и предоставляет еще более мощные возможности работы с файлами Excel. Она поддерживает чтение и запись файлов Excel в форматах XLSX, XLS, CSV, ODS и других.

Для использования библиотеки PHPSpreadsheet необходимо сначала установить ее на свой сервер. После этого можно начать извлекать данные из Excel-файлов. Вот пример кода, который можно использовать для чтения данных из файла Excel с помощью библиотеки PHPSpreadsheet:

require 'vendor/autoload.php';
use PhpOffice\PhpSpreadsheet\IOFactory;
$inputFileType = 'Xlsx';
$inputFileName = 'example.xlsx';
$spreadsheet = IOFactory::load($inputFileName);
$worksheet = $spreadsheet->getActiveSheet();
$highestRow = $worksheet->getHighestRow();
$highestColumn = $worksheet->getHighestColumn();
$data = array();
for ($row = 1; $row <= $highestRow; $row++) {
for ($col = 'A'; $col <= $highestColumn; $col++) {
$value = $worksheet->getCell($col.$row)->getValue();
$data[$row][$col] = $value;
}
}

Таким образом, извлечение данных из файла Excel в PHP может быть выполнено с помощью различных библиотек, таких как PHPExcel и PHPSpreadsheet. Эти библиотеки предоставляют удобные методы для чтения данных из Excel-файлов и могут быть использованы в различных PHP-проектах.

Работа с различными форматами и структурами файла excel в phpexcel

PHPExcel — это мощная библиотека PHP, которая позволяет работать с файлами Excel разных форматов и структур. Она предоставляет удобные и гибкие инструменты для чтения и записи данных в файлы Excel, а также обработки этих данных.

PHPExcel поддерживает такие форматы Excel, как XLS, XLSX и CSV, что позволяет работать с файлами в различных версиях Excel. Библиотека также предоставляет возможность работы с различными структурами данных в файлах Excel, такими как таблицы, диаграммы, графики и даже макросы.

Для чтения данных из файла Excel в PHPExcel необходимо создать объект класса PHPExcel, загрузить файл Excel и выбрать нужный лист для работы. Затем можно использовать различные методы и свойства библиотеки для получения данных из ячеек, столбцов или строк.

Кроме того, PHPExcel позволяет записывать данные в файл Excel. Для этого необходимо создать новый объект класса PHPExcel, заполнить его данными и сохранить в нужном формате.

Работа с файлами Excel в PHPExcel позволяет не только читать и записывать данные, но и выполнять различные операции с этими данными, такие как сортировка, фильтрация, форматирование и т. д. Благодаря мощным возможностям PHPExcel, работа с файлами Excel в PHP становится простой и удобной задачей.

Преимущества работы с различными форматами и структурами файла Excel в PHPExcel:

  • Гибкость и мощность: PHPExcel позволяет работать с файлами Excel разных форматов и структур, что обеспечивает широкие возможности обработки данных;
  • Простота использования: библиотека предоставляет простой и понятный интерфейс для работы с файлами Excel, что упрощает разработку и обслуживание кода;
  • Эффективность: PHPExcel обладает высокой производительностью и эффективностью при чтении и записи данных, что позволяет обрабатывать большие объемы данных без проблем;
  • Расширяемость: библиотека позволяет разрабатывать собственные расширения и дополнения для работы с файлами Excel, что позволяет адаптировать ее под конкретные потребности проекта.

В итоге, работа с различными форматами и структурами файла Excel в PHPExcel является удобным и эффективным способом обработки данных из файлов Excel в PHP. Благодаря мощным возможностям библиотеки, разработчики могут легко читать и записывать данные в файлы Excel, а также выполнять различные операции с этими данными.

Окончание

В данной статье мы рассмотрели процесс обработки и анализа данных, содержащихся в файле Excel с использованием библиотеки PHPExcel. Мы изучили основные шаги для чтения и записи данных в Excel файлы, а также применение различных методов и функций для работы с этими данными.

Библиотека PHPExcel предоставляет удобные инструменты для работы с файлами Excel, позволяя легко считывать и записывать данные, форматировать ячейки, вычислять значения и многое другое. Это отличное средство для проведения анализа данных, создания отчетов и автоматизации рутинных задач.

Мы рассмотрели основные функции и методы библиотеки PHPExcel, такие как чтение и запись данных, форматирование ячеек, вычисление значений, работа с формулами, стилей и многое другое. Теперь у вас есть все необходимые знания, чтобы использовать данную библиотеку в своих проектах и получать максимальную пользу от работы с данными Excel.

Помните, что качество обработки и анализа данных является ключевым фактором для получения точных и достоверных результатов. Тщательно проводите проверку и проверку ваших данных перед их обработкой, используйте подходящие методы и инструменты для анализа данных и будьте внимательными при интерпретации результатов.

Оцените статью